k8s安装之node节点

来源:互联网 

kubernetes node

安装kubelet
wget https://storage.googleapis.com/kubernetes-release/release/v1.11.0/kubernetes-server-linux-amd64.tar.gz
tar -xzvf kubernetes-server-linux-amd64.tar.gz
cd kubernetes
tar -zxf kubernetes-src.tar.gz
scp kubernetes/server/bin/{kube-proxy,kubelet} k8s-node1:/usr/local/bin/
scp kubernetes/server/bin/{kube-proxy,kubelet} k8s-node2:/usr/local/bin/
##### 生成kubelet权限,下面这条命令只在master点执行一次即可

kubectl create clusterrolebinding kubelet-bootstrap --clusterrole=system:node-bootstrapper --user=kubelet-bootstrap
######说明
kubelet 启动时向 kube-apiserver 发送 TLS bootstrapping 请求,需要先将 bootstrap token 文件中的 kubelet-bootstrap 用户赋予 system:node-bootstrapper 角色,然后 kubelet 才有权限创建认证请求
1.8版本之前.开启rbac后,apiserver默认绑定system:nodes组到system:node的clusterrole。v1.8之后,此绑定默认不存在,需要手工绑定,否则kubelet启动后会报认证错误,使用kubectl get nodes查看无法成为Ready状态。
kubectl create clusterrolebinding kubelet-node-clusterbinding --clusterrole=system:node --group=system:nodes
######创建启动文件

/usr/lib/systemd/system/kubelet.service
[Unit]
Description=Kubernetes Kubelet Server
Documentation=https://github.com/GoogleCloudPlatform/kubernetes
After=docker.service
Requires=docker.service

[Service]
WorkingDirectory=/var/lib/kubelet
ExecStart=/usr/local/sbin/kubelet \
            --address=172.16.20.206 \
            --hostname-override=172.16.20.206 \
            --cluster-dns=10.254.0.2 \
            --network-plugin=cni \
            --cni-conf-dir=/etc/cni/net.d \
            --cni-bin-dir=/opt/cni/bin \
            --logtostderr=true \
            --v=2 \
            --allow-privileged=true \
            --pod-infra-container-image=registry.cn-hangzhou.aliyuncs.com/google_containers/pause-amd64:3.1 \
            --cgroups-per-qos \
            --cgroup-driver=cgroupfs \
            --experimental-bootstrap-kubeconfig=/etc/kubernetes/bootstrap.kubeconfig \
            --kubeconfig=/etc/kubernetes/kubelet.kubeconfig \
            --cert-dir=/etc/kubernetes/ssl --cluster-domain=cluster.local \
            --hairpin-mode promiscuous-bridge \
            --serialize-image-pulls=false \
            --runtime-cgroups=/systemd/system.slice \
            --kubelet-cgroups=/systemd/system.slice \
            --enforce-node-allocatable=pods \
            --kube-reserved=cpu=1,memory=2Gi,ephemeral-storage=5Gi \
            --system-reserved=cpu=1,memory=2Gi,ephemeral-storage=5Gi \
            --eviction-hard=memory.available<1Gi,nodefs.available<10%
Restart=on-failure
RestartSec=5

[Install]
